Runaway pet
| Title: | Runaway pet |
| Description: | Caption: "Runaway pet--A. S. P. C. A. worker Morris Thomas holds the indigo snake which turned up ... [at] Waldbaum's Super Market at 1399 Coney Island Ave. Snake escaped a month ago from home where it had been kept as a pet." |
| Date: | 1951 |
| Location: | Brooklyn (New York, N.Y.) |
| Creator: | Brooklyn eagle. |
| More Details: |
Grease pencil cropping marks; retouched. On verso: date stamped: Aug. 28, 1951; Brooklyn Eagle stamp. Title from caption on verso. |
